# Break-Glass Access — Quillbus Broker Upgrade

Hey release folks — if the Quillbus 4.x upgrade goes sideways and the admin console won't respond, this is your break-glass path. Don't use it for routine ops; every use pages the platform lead and gets logged in the Harrowfield audit stream.

Steps: stop the rolling upgrade, drain the Pindlecreek nodes, then unseal the broker's emergency config vault from the standby host. The unseal prompt asks for the current recovery passphrase, which is kept right below.

unlock words, hahip-baduf: holwyn-istath-julvan

### 14:22 — Font Vendoring Incident, Step 4

At this point, Priya from the Lanthorn platform team confirmed that the third-party Verrisole font bundle had been vendored into the Kestwick static tree without its license manifest, which broke the provenance check in CI. She reverted the vendoring commit, restored the manifest from the archival mirror in the Dunmoor region, and kicked off a clean rebuild with full attestation enabled. The rebuild completed at 14:31, and its trace token is recorded immediately below this entry.

build token for kagaf-hahof: htk14_9d3d4d26d7d8de

## Authentication

Heads up: the nightly reindex job (`reindex_nightly.py`) talks to the Lanternfish search cluster, and that cluster won't accept anonymous writes anymore — we locked it down last sprint. The job now authenticates as the `reindex-runner` service identity against Corvid Gateway, and the token is injected via the `LF_INDEX_TOKEN` env var in the scheduler config. Nothing clever going on, just a bearer header on every batch request. For review purposes, the staging credential currently in use is listed below.

service key, kadug-kadup: kto15_rN23XLAYImmZgrJ